Red de conocimiento informático - Problemas con los teléfonos móviles - public void doDelete (solicitud HttpServletRequest, respuesta HttpServletResponse) lanza ServletExcept

public void doDelete (solicitud HttpServletRequest, respuesta HttpServletResponse) lanza ServletExcept

Este código implementa principalmente la función de eliminación

public void doDelete(solicitud HttpServletRequest,

respuesta HttpServletResponse) lanza ServletException, IOException {

respuesta.setContentType("texto / html; charset=UTF-8"); //establecer codificación de respuesta

SmallCategoryService smallCategoryInfoService = new SmallCategoryService(); //Crea una instancia de la clase de capa empresarial para la función de eliminación, que contiene métodos de eliminación específicos

int smallCategoryId = Integer.parseInt(request. getParameter("smallid")); //obtiene el número de ID que se eliminará de la solicitud, lo que viene en la solicitud es de tipo String, necesita conversión de tipo

prueba {

smallCategoryInfoService.deleteSmallCategory( smallCategoryId); //método de eliminación específico

doList(solicitud, respuesta); //La operación finaliza y regresa. es un método de devolución de uso común, no es tan simple que LZ necesite echar un vistazo

} catch (Exception e) {//Manejo de excepciones

request.setAttribute("errorStr). ", "Error de operación, verifique la conexión de la base de datos"); //Mensaje de excepción

RequestDispatcher Dispatcher = request

. getRequestDispatcher("... /error.jsp"); //Después del manejo de excepciones La página a redirigir

Dispatcher.forward(request, Response); //Operación de reenvío, la operación de redireccionamiento anterior debe ser similar a esta

e.printStackTrace (); //imprimir mensaje de error

}

}